The Rise of E-commerce in South Africa Amidst the Pandemic

Date:

As the global pandemic continues to evolve, South African businesses are finding new ways to adapt and thrive. One of the major shifts we have seen is the unprecedented growth in the e-commerce sector. With lockdowns and social distancing measures, online shopping has become not just a convenience, but a necessity for many South Africans.

E-commerce Trends

Over the past year, there has been a significant increase in the number of online consumers. According to a study by World Wide Worx, the growth of online retail in South Africa has surged by 66% in 2020, making it the fastest-growing digital economy in Africa.

While initially, the spike in online shopping was driven by lockdown measures, it seems the trend is here to stay as consumers have experienced the convenience and safety it offers. From groceries to home decor, South Africans are turning to online platforms for their shopping needs.

Adapting to the Digital Sphere

For businesses, this growth in e-commerce presents both challenges and opportunities. Many traditional brick-and-mortar stores have had to quickly adapt to the digital sphere, developing online platforms for their products and services. This transition has not been easy, with businesses facing challenges such as logistics, stock management, and customer service in a digital environment.

However, those who have been able to successfully pivot to online retail are reaping the benefits. The digital economy allows businesses to reach a larger and more diverse customer base, opening up new markets and opportunities.

The Future of E-commerce in South Africa

While the growth of e-commerce in South Africa has been accelerated by the pandemic, it is clear that this trend is not just a temporary response to the current circumstances. As technology continues to evolve and consumers become more comfortable with online shopping, the digital economy will continue to play a key role in South Africa’s economic development.

As we move forward, businesses will need to continue to adapt and innovate, finding new ways to meet the needs of their online customers. The rise of e-commerce is just the beginning of South Africa’s digital revolution.
